Simon Riggs <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> writes:
> There were only 2 lock delays for FirstLockMgrLock in SHARED mode, so it
> seems believable that there were 0 lock delays in EXCLUSIVE mode.

Not really, considering the extremely limited use of LW_SHARED in lock.c
(GetLockConflicts is used only by CREATE INDEX CONCURRENTLY, and
GetLockStatusData only by the pg_locks view).  For the type of benchmark
that I gather this is, there should be *zero* LW_SHARED acquisitions at
all.  And even if there are some, they could only be blocking against
the (undoubtedly much more frequent) LW_EXCLUSIVE acquisitions; it's not
very credible that there is zero contention among the LW_EXCLUSIVE locks
yet a few shared acquirers manage to get burnt.
